
Checked Thursday, June 4, 2026: Steam has a small but useful batch of temporary free game offers heading into the weekend. Some are free to keep, meaning you add them to your Steam library and they should remain attached to your account after the claim window ends. One is play for free, meaning you can try it during the free window, but you do not permanently own it unless you buy it.

The main customer-facing offers I found from the current SteamDB free promotions list are Winexy, Tell Me Why, Gravity Circuit, and Marathon. Tell Me Why is the easiest recommendation in this list if you like narrative games. Steam describes it as an award-winning episodic adventure about twins using a supernatural bond to uncover the truth about their past. It is developed by DONTNOD Entertainment and published by Xbox Game Studios.
This is not a fast arcade game. It is a slower, story-first adventure with heavier themes, choices, and emotional scenes. Steam lists the game with a 17+ age requirement, so parents should check the store page before installing it for younger players.

Gravity Circuit is normally listed at $16.99 on Steam, and SteamDB showed it as a 100% discount during this promotion. It is a flashy 2D action platformer from Domesticated Ant Games, published by PID Games and Dear Villagers. Steam’s description frames it as a console-classic-style action game starring Kai, a war hero using the mysterious Gravity Circuit in a futuristic world of sentient robots.
This is probably the best “claim it even if you are not installing today” title in the current batch. It has a longer claim window than Winexy, but free-to-keep promotions are still temporary. If you enjoy Mega Man-style movement, boss fights, and tight platforming, add this one to your account while it is still free.

Marathon is Bungie’s high-stakes survival first-person shooter set around the lost colony of Tau Ceti IV. Steam’s current store metadata lists it as a multiplayer, PvP, online PvP, cross-platform multiplayer title with partial controller support and family sharing. The store price at the time of this check showed a separate paid discount, but the free promotion is a temporary play window.
This is the one to treat differently. You are not claiming a permanent copy. You are getting a chance to test the game during the free window and decide whether the multiplayer loop, performance, matchmaking, and controls feel good enough for you. If you have limited time this weekend, install it early because larger multiplayer games can take a while to download and patch.
